    Yes links to your homepage does help subpages to rank as well once the pagerank and link-juice reach the subpages, but the subpages will recieve less pr/juice then it would if the link was a direct link to the subpage.

    Deep backlink = backlink pointing deep into your website. Eg individual blog pages rather than your homepage.
